About Shuichi Jono
Shuichi Jono is a scholar working on Nephrology, Rheumatology and Immunology and Allergy, having authored 39 papers that have together received 3.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Parathyroid Disorders and Treatments (21 papers), Bone Metabolism and Diseases (11 papers) and Bone and Dental Protein Studies (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nephrology (2.3k citations),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(485 citations) and Rheumatology (825 citations). Shuichi Jono has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Yoshiki Nishizawà, Atsushi Shioi, Hirotoshi Morii, Katsuhito Mori, Cecilia M. Giachelli, Marc D. McKee, Charles E. Murry, Yuji Ikari, Hidenori Koyama and Kazuhiro Hara.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Circulation and Journal of the American College of Cardiology.
